How it's made
Structure and Main Components:
- Grinding Wheel Body: The body is made of durable steel to withstand high speeds and mechanical stress during operation. The structure is designed to ensure stability and reduce vibration.
- Grinding wheel: The grinding wheel itself has a maximum diameter of 500 mm. It is designed to provide an abrasive surface for processing materials. The quality and type of abrasive depend on the type of processing and the material being treated.
- Motor: The grinding wheel motor is designed to reach variable speeds between 1900 and 3400 rpm, offering the possibility of adapting the speed to specific processing needs.
- Safety Device: Quality machines like the AJF are equipped with safety devices to protect the operator from splinters and dust.
Measurements and Mechanical Characteristics
- Maximum Grinding Wheel Diameter: 500 mm
- Revolutions: Variable between 1900 and 3400 rpm
- Working Surface Speed: 50 m/s
- Power: Motor power depends on the specific model, but is designed to handle high loads and speeds.
Technical features:
- Speed Adjustability: The ability to adjust the speed allows you to optimize the processing based on the material and the operation.
- Operational Stability: The sturdy construction of the grinding wheel body ensures low vibration and long life.
Mathematical Formulas for Characteristics
-
Working Surface Velocity (V): Can be calculated with the formula: V=π×D×N60V = \frac{\pi \times D \times N}{60} V = 60 π × D × N Where
- DD D is the diameter of the grinding wheel (500 mm).
- NN N is the speed in revolutions per minute (can vary between 1900 and 3400).
-
Power Required: The power required for the grinding wheel can be estimated by considering the load and speed. The general formula is: P=T×N9550P = \frac{T \times N}{9550} P = 9550 T × N Where
- TT T is the torque.
- NN N is the speed in revolutions per minute.
How to use it
- Preparation: Make sure the grinder is mounted on a stable base and that the motor and power supply are properly connected.
- Mounting the Grinding Wheel: Attach the grinding wheel to the machine spindle. Make sure it is properly aligned and secure.
- Speed Setting: Adjust the motor speed according to the type of material and the desired processing.
- Usage: Turn on the wheel and begin the grinding or finishing process, maintaining uniform and controlled pressure on the surface to be worked.
- Cleaning and Maintenance: After use, clean the grinding wheel to remove dust and debris. Regularly check the wheel's balance and motor condition.
